			<p>The <strong>Limelight Marketplace</strong> is basically a high-end mall operating out of a decommissioned Episcopal church on Sixth Ave and 20th Street in New York &#8212; that popper-lined Xanadu known as <strong>Chelsea</strong>. With sales and popularity ever dwindling, its owner <strong>Jack Menashe</strong> is planning a $4 million overhaul to turn it into a department store &#8212; &#8220;not unlike<strong> Barneys</strong>&#8221; &#8212; that will be known simply as <strong>Limelight</strong>.</p>
<p><a href="http://ficdn.fashionindie.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/06/NY-AZ152_nylime_G_20110530175449.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-197306" title="NY-AZ152_nylime_G_20110530175449" src="http://ficdn.fashionindie.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/06/NY-AZ152_nylime_G_20110530175449.jpg" alt="Limelight Marketplace to Get a Level of Sophisticatedness" width="553" height="369" /></a><span id="more-197305"></span></p>
<p>Originally a nightclub in the 80s and 90s, the original Limelight closed about 10 years ago and went through a series of other nightlife reincarnations before the marketplace was born in May of last year.</p>
<p>I personally remember when Limelight was known as Avalon during my gay-underaged-college-partying days, though I&#8217;ve never been to the marketplace. Mostly because a.) I hate malls &#8212; especially in Manhattan; this isn&#8217;t Jersey, give me a storefront &#8212; and b.) it just sounded <a href="http://nymag.com/daily/fashion/2010/05/the_new_limelight_your_one-sto.html" target="_blank">all kinds of bougie</a>. And not in the fun, <em>Real Housewives of Beverly Hills</em> way.</p>
<p>But now that the bloom is off that rose, Menashe is changing direction and has already gutted some of that fancy dead weight: &#8220;We just actually terminated a bunch of tenants, so the whole main floor is being opened up now.&#8221; Heartwarming.</p>
<p>Along with the department store makeover, Limelight will also get an aesthetic makeover with a stronger fashion angle. The stainglass windows will be more visible thanks to all of those wiped out tenants, the walls will be darker, the lights will be dimmer but the DJ wil continue to play on.</p>
<p>Oh, yeah, there&#8217;s a DJ &#8212; leftover in a pile of glitter and cocaine from one of <strong>Amanda Lepore</strong>&#8216;s orgiastic wild nights some ten years ago, no doubt.</p>
<p>By giving Limelight a darker, moodier atmosphere, Menashe hopes to &#8220;add a level of sophisticatedness to it, if that&#8217;s a word.&#8221; It&#8217;s not, but good luck anyway, Jack.</p>

			<p>Though <strong>Heatherette</strong> is all but ancient history, <strong>Richie Rich</strong> is still a glam club kid at heart.  Amidst a sea of models – bones and high ponytails from wall to ceiling – I met up with the designer and his design director <strong>Angelo Lambrou</strong> during a casting call for Richie’s runway show. This will be his second collection for his eponymous label and will be held at the <strong>Hammerstein Ballroom</strong> on February 10th at 9 pm. Proceeds will go to benefit two causes very close to Richie’s sequined heart: <strong><a href="http://www.dosomething.org/" target="_blank">DoSomething.org</a></strong> and <strong><a href="http://www.cookiesforkidscancer.org/" target="_blank">Cookies for Kids&#8217; Cancer</a>. </strong>We discussed Richie’s fabulous inspirations, his fabulous friends and the first time he met <strong>Madonna</strong>. Which was, you guessed it, fabulous.</p>
<p><a rel="attachment wp-att-183758" href="http://fashionindie.com/interview-the-glittery-world-of-richie-rich/2011-01-28-16-41-18-2/"><img class="aligncenter size-large wp-image-183758" title="2011-01-28-16.41.18" src="http://ficdn.fashionindie.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/02/2011-01-28-16.41.181-560x420.jpg" alt="Interview: The Glittery World of Richie Rich" width="560" height="420" /></a><span id="more-183757"></span></p>
<p><em>On this season’s aesthetic</em>:</p>
<p>It’s sort of 20s/30s glamour meets East Village punkiness/funkiness. Imagine if Marie Antoinette fell out of the sky and landed in the middle of the East Village. We’re just going to let her have fun. But it’s going to be more refined and upscale.</p>
<p><em> On his partnership with Angelo</em>:</p>
<p>Angelo’s kind of my design director, we’re a team, doing this line together. I hate titles, that’s the thing, but we’re having fun. We met on 7th St when I had my line, Heatherette, that was my studio. But he’s right across the street still on 7th St.  Keeping it real with the East Village. I was looking for someone to partner up with me and have fun and direct my crazy mind. It’s like when you decorate the Christmas tree, if you have too many ideas you need to edit it…I think Angelo brings refinement to my glittery fun.</p>
<p><em>On his upcoming runway show</em>:</p>
<p>The show this season is on February 10th at the Hammerstein Ballroom. Fashion Week is usually very exclusive, invite only, but I’m opening my show up like a rock concert this year, letting people in who never really get a chance to go to a fashion show.</p>
<p>I never realized, like a lot of my friends that aren’t in the fashion industry,  I’ll invite them to my show and they’re like, &#8220;Oh my god, it was so much fun! I’ve never been to a fashion show before.&#8221; I always take it for granted because that’s what I do. It’s fun when people who haven’t experienced it get a chance to and see what it’s about. And it’s as much fun to watch the crowd as it is to watch the show.</p>
<p>This year I&#8217;m selling <a href="http://www.richierich.eventbrite.com/" target="_blank">tickets to the show</a> and proceeds go to DOsomething.org as well as Cookies for Kids&#8217; Cancer, which is a charity for little kids who unfortunately have cancer. We have a good friend who passed away in the last couple days…It felt weird at first, selling tickets, but you know if you can help people it makes sense.</p>
<p>Then again this spring, I think I’m going to do another show to launch a partnership with a Fast Fashion House. I guess I’ll be the first designer that’s ever been the face of something they’ve done.</p>
<p><a rel="attachment wp-att-183759" href="http://fashionindie.com/interview-the-glittery-world-of-richie-rich/2011-01-28-15-59-47-2/"><img class="aligncenter size-large wp-image-183759" title="2011-01-28-15.59.47" src="http://ficdn.fashionindie.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/02/2011-01-28-15.59.471-560x420.jpg" alt="Interview: The Glittery World of Richie Rich" width="560" height="420" /></a><br />
<em></em></p>
<p><em>On casting models</em>:</p>
<p>I look for personality. There are so many beautiful people out there that model. I don’t like one kind of look, I like everything. That’s why I love New York. It’s like an 80’s <strong>Bennetton</strong> ad. You have the amazing black girl with the Asian kid and the gay kid…I just think we all wear clothes, you don’t have to be a size 0 because beauty comes in all sizes.</p>
<p><em> On pre-Fashion Week jitters</em>:</p>
<p>I don’t get nervous, really, it’s more like happy nerves, excited, energetic. I’m always like what if nobody shows up? I probably asked my mom that before my fifth birthday party. I don’t really get nervous or scared or intimidated, I’m more excited like it’s Christmas Eve. I just want everybody to come and have a good time.</p>
<p>The worst part is when something goes wrong, like when kids can’t get in or something’s wrong with the door. I’m backstage trying to get everything together and I have all these friends on the alert. You don’t know what’s going on and you end up getting in trouble the next three days or five months. That’s where the nerves come from. That’s the nerve-wracking part.</p>
<p><em> On other fashion shows he’s looking forward to</em>:</p>
<p>I always look forward to all of it. I go to <strong>Marc Jacobs</strong> every year. He’s an old friend. I love him, he’s supported me a long time as well. But I just go with the flow. Fashion Week is such a rollercoaster, that’s why I like doing opening night because then it’s over with and I can just have fun.</p>
<p><a rel="attachment wp-att-183765" href="http://fashionindie.com/interview-the-glittery-world-of-richie-rich/20100909_ellenrichierich_560x375-2/"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-183765" title="20100909_ellenrichierich_560x375" src="http://ficdn.fashionindie.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/02/20100909_ellenrichierich_560x3751.jpg" alt="Interview: The Glittery World of Richie Rich" width="560" height="375" /></a></p>
<p><em> On his celebrity friends walking the runway</em>:</p>
<p>I didn’t really intend, when I started doing fashion shows, to have celebrities at the end. They just happened to be my friends and were out and about. A lot of people in the media are like, &#8220;Who are you having this season?&#8221; Your guess is as good as mine. I usually just call up some of my friends, ask if they want to do this. If it’s part of a charity, even better. It just kind of unfolds.</p>
<p>I’ll definitely have surprises this season. I don’t know the surprises until they happen. They’re really always last minute. Last year <strong>Ellen</strong> [<strong>Degeneres</strong>] finally called two days before [the show]…</p>
<p>I remember one season, <strong>Britney Spears</strong> and <strong>Paris Hilton</strong> were in a fight. So Paris is in one car and Britney is in another car. I went out to get them but they both knew each other was there. I didn’t know they were feuding and they decided not to come out of their cars.</p>
<p>And <strong>Kimora Lee</strong> was also walking so she&#8217;s like, &#8220;Well, where are Paris and Britney?&#8221; I said they’re not coming out and Kimora goes &#8220;Well I guess I’m the finale!&#8221;</p>
<p><a rel="attachment wp-att-183760" href="http://fashionindie.com/interview-the-glittery-world-of-richie-rich/00490m-8/"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-183760" title="00490m" src="http://ficdn.fashionindie.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/02/00490m1.jpg" alt="Interview: The Glittery World of Richie Rich" width="320" height="480" /></a></p>
<p>Kimora was great, I like having other designers walk. I think it should all be a big family. I don’t believe in the whole competitive thing, we’re all having fun for the same reason.</p>
<p><em> On meeting his icons</em>:</p>
<p>My friends enticed me to move to New York and I sort of moved here on a whim. The night I came they threw a party for me at this club in Union Square. I had long finger waves and was wearing this discoball-ish headpiece when Madonna walks up to me with a beer and a cigarette in hand.  She just kind of looked at me like, &#8220;Who is this?&#8221; and said, &#8220;Hey, what’s up?&#8221;</p>
<p>I’ve always been a huge fan, obviously, of hers – and I was just like, &#8220;WOW. I’m staying in New York!&#8221;</p>
<p>And the next night, I was living at the Hotel 17 in Gramercy Park with my friend <strong>Amanda Lepore</strong>, who was my neighbor and <strong>David Bowie</strong> was in the elevator with me. I grew up with my brother loving David Bowie. We ended up doing a photoshoot literally outside of my hotel room with Interviewmagazine. Then two nights later I met <strong>Debbie Harry</strong>!</p>
<p>New York came alive in a week. It just felt like it was meant to be. I think that’s why I appreciate fashion and pop culture so much: the sheer will of having a dream, letting it unfold and hopefully inspiring other people to realize their dreams. Which is what all those artists have done for me.</p>
<p><em> On his own style</em>:</p>
<p>I pretty much wear everything from <strong>Dots </strong>and <strong>H&amp;M</strong> mixed with <strong>Chanel</strong>, everything from Marc Jacobs to <strong>Prada</strong>, <strong>Dior</strong>, <strong>The</strong> <strong>Gap</strong>, vintage. I’m just all over the map. I think if you think too much it doesn’t make sense.</p>
<p>But on the flip side, if you do a fashion shoot and somebody else styles you, it’s fun to see how they envision you. Like popstars for example. It’s not really their vision, but somebody else giving it to them. Even <strong>Gaga</strong>, she’s bringing back to the surface what club kids did for years, but she’s smart about it. She has good people around her.</p>
<p><strong>Kate Moss</strong>’s best friend, he’s gay, told me there’s always a good f****t around any fabulous girl. [laughs]</p>

<p>David LaChapelle has his own way of doing an art opening. Last night at Paul Kasmin Gallery, for the vernissage of his <em>American Jesus</em> show, he had cameos from Julian Schnabel and Lenny Kravitz (<em>pictured above</em>, with LaChapelle and Amanda Lepore) and a crowd of people photographing him as he danced—in a white caftan, no less. As it happened, there was a <em>Jersey Shore</em> party going on at the same time next door at Marquee—”probably a metaphor for my life,” LaChapelle shrugged.</p>
<p>That life is a busy one at the moment, with Chelsea the latest stop on the attention-getting show’s world tour. The abridged <em>American Jesus</em> exhibition at Paul Kasmin puts extra focus on three photos depicting the late Michael Jackson (well, a lookalike) as Christ and features a striking image of Naomi Campbell as Cleopatra. A broadly expanded version of the show opens at the Tel Aviv Museum of Art later this month. “It’s going to go on until people don’t want to see it any more, I guess,” LaChapelle said at the Standard’s High Line Room, where he was joined by the likes of Cynthia Rowley and Rory Tahari for the post-opening dinner. Speaking of going on, so did the party—the LaChapelle crew adjourned upstairs to the Boom Boom Room for some postprandial dancing, where they mixed with the likes of Yigal Azrouël and J.Crew’s Jenna Lyons. It was the last Boom, so to speak—the final late night of BBR revelry before the space is reborn as a private club after the summer. LaChapelle’s own take on resurrection? “I believe that there’s more to me than what’s contained between my hat and my shoes,” he said.</p>

<p style="text-align: left">Before you read too much into this post and begin labeling me a &#8220;homophobe&#8221;, let me pre-fence this post by stating my view. I believe that every man and woman has the right to choose the way they want to live, as long as the way they live does not impose on the rights of others.  Sexuality is more than a choice, it is a right that each of us deserve.</p>
<p style="text-align: left">Now on to the juicy bits&#8230;</p>
<p style="text-align: left">This fashion season was strung full of the type of shows you&#8217;d only normally see at a very special night at <span style="font-style: italic" class="Apple-style-span">The Cock</span> (NYC nightclub for those not in the know).  Men paraded around in womans underwear as the line between androgyny and sexuality were crossed to produce a metaphoric smorgasbord of shock and awe over the sillohettes of masculintity taking over the long delicate curves of the female staple, the dress. It was seen at<span style="font-weight: bold" class="Apple-style-span"> Marcos Hal</span>l (his invitation feature Andre J wearing one of his signature looks) and at <span style="font-weight: bold" class="Apple-style-span">New York Couture</span> (a show we sponsored and fully supported). Whether is be drag queen or cross dresser, tranny or something altogether different, it seemed like amongst the indie designers, it was finally okay to be &#8220;a boy in a dress&#8221;.  </p>
<p style="text-align: left">But was it really &#8220;okay&#8221;?  Did the looks that came clogging down the runway in size 14 heels really appeal to the end user, the woman who would eventually wear the dress?  I&#8217;m still looking for answers on this one, but it seems that the few women I spoke to displayed a general disinterest or disconnect when a man is rocking a look that was made for her body.</p>
<p style="text-align: center"> <img src="http://fashionindie.lookbooks.netdna-cdn.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/02/andre_j_male.jpg" alt="Daniel Saynt Asks : Should Men Be Allowed on a Womans Runway?"  title="Daniel Saynt Asks : Should Men Be Allowed on a Womans Runway?" /></p>
<p style="text-align: center"><span style="font-style: italic" class="Apple-style-span">Andre J walking Marcos Hall </span></p>
<p style="text-align: left"><span style="font-weight: bold" class="Apple-style-span">Andre J</span>, the bearded, &#8220;not a tranny, not a drag queen&#8221; model, has been getting a ton of attention for his over the top persona.  Running with a crew that includes<span style="font-weight: bold" class="Apple-style-span"> Amanda Lepor</span>e, the <span style="font-weight: bold" class="Apple-style-span">Heatherette</span> and <span style="font-weight: bold" class="Apple-style-span">David LaChapelle</span> darling, who lost her &#8220;twig and berries&#8221; years ago, Andre J seems to be a rising star in the game, making the cover of<span style="font-weight: bold" class="Apple-style-span"> French Vogue</span> and recently landing on <a href="http://coacd.blogspot.com/">Confessions of a Casting Directors</a> Top 25 of 2007 list.  </p>
<p style="text-align: left">But in an industry where the attitude is &#8220;the less you see of a model the better&#8221;, will a 6 foot tall man with a beard really help sell a dress or will he just distract from the real purpose of a fashion show? </p>
<p style="text-align: center"> <img src="http://fashionindie.lookbooks.netdna-cdn.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/02/men_in_dresses.jpg" alt="Daniel Saynt Asks : Should Men Be Allowed on a Womans Runway?"  title="Daniel Saynt Asks : Should Men Be Allowed on a Womans Runway?" /></p>
<p> I guess the real question comes down to where or not the looks are &#8220;spectacle&#8221; or &#8220;spectacular&#8221;. If a designer creates a collection that is truly amazing, does it really mater how it&#8217;s presented on the runway?  Or should a designer play it safe and stick with the classic mantra, &#8220;let boys be boys, and girls be girls&#8221; to keep the runway free from confusion?  Weigh in and discuss indies cause personally I feel that with Heatherette down and out, it may be a very long time before a boy makes it back onto the runways of Bryant Park. Are you for or against men in dresses on the fashion runways?  </p>
